红联Linux门户
Linux帮助

为什么/bin下的常用执行文件的命令文件用Vi编辑器打不开

发布时间:2012-04-11 10:42:56来源:红联作者:mr_tianwei
比如/bin 下的cp用vi 打开就是乱码,等等很多打开都是乱码。求解释
文章评论

共有 8 条评论

  1. 于 2014-03-22 21:11:01发表:

    用bvi命令打开二进制文件

  2. 相思爱文 于 2012-05-07 23:04:27发表:

    二进制文件是给机器看了,读不了。想知道相关命令文件的内在原理,可以下载源码阅读。

    直接对二进制反汇编,属逆向工程。一般在没源码的情况下才使用。

  3. allan5220 于 2012-04-12 08:06:25发表:

    难道楼主想用记事本编辑.exe文件?

  4. 奶茶dsk 于 2012-04-11 22:06:30发表:

    引用:
    那二进制文件怎么读取呢
    mr_tianwei 发表于 2012-4-11 20:29



    二进制文件都是机器码,读出来有什么意义?

    反汇编看汇编代码?

  5. wyanchao 于 2012-04-11 21:46:10发表:

    bin里面的文件都是二进制的!所以用vi打开都是乱码~

  6. mr_tianwei 于 2012-04-11 20:29:27发表:

    那二进制文件怎么读取呢

  7. 奶茶dsk 于 2012-04-11 19:21:00发表:

    可执行文件为二进制流,非ascii码。。

  8. 于 2012-04-11 19:08:06发表:

    什么叫“执行文件的命令文件”?